Abstract
Milne's time-dependent equation of transfer of trapped radiation in finite absorbing medium has been exactly solved by a combination of Das Gupta's modified form of the Wiener-Hopf technique and method of solving boundary value problems in the theory of heat conduction as adopted by Chandrasekhar (1950) to solve the same equation approximately in combination with his method of discrete ordinates. Milne himself had earlier obtained an approximate solution of his equation.
